Efficiency Analysis of Materials Used for Mechanical Methods for Damp Masonry Rehabilitation

The issue of rehabilitation of buildings due to the effects of soil and atmospheric humidity is very difficult and in the field of present civil engineering it creates an independent and highly specialized discipline. The paper deals with laboratory determination of the efficiency of the mechanical methods for rehabilitation of damp brick masonry against the effect of ground capillary moisture. The assessed materials of mechanical undercut masonry are bitumen waterproofing and waterproofing membranes and also mechanically hammered in waterproofing metal sheet made of high-quality stainless steel. The comparison was made not only between particular materials, but also with reference samples without previous waterproofing.
